Finding the Right Employment Law Attorney: Key Considerations
Securing a experienced employment attorney is critical when facing workplace problems. Evaluate several factors when making your choice. First, look for an attorney who specializes in employment law; general practitioners may lack the needed expertise. Confirm their qualifications, including professional admissions and any disciplinary actions. Read online reviews and testimonials to gauge employee satisfaction. Finally, schedule consultations with a few candidates to assess their communication style and ensure you feel comfortable discussing your sensitive situation.
Your Legal Recourse After Unfair Dismissal or Harassment
If you've experienced the illegal firing or suffered bullying at work, understanding your potential legal options is vital. You might be able to submit a complaint with the appropriate agency, such as the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(the Commission) or a similar state organization. Alternatively, you could consider bringing a civil claim against your business, seeking compensation for financial losses, emotional distress, and other related suffering. Consulting with an experienced employment lawyer is strongly suggested to assess the merits of your case and understand the specific procedures involved in protecting your rights.
